Well since the blower was on the car before you bought it, do you know how many miles the blower has on it? Also, you probably don't know of the conditions it has been through before you got it. Does it have shaft play or movement? I would guess that a bearing is out that allowed it to rub against the compressor cover. Would definetly see what vortech says about a rebuild cost before just dropping 1.5k on another headunit.

The fins were still rubbing for about 1/2 of each rotation. You can visually see that the bolt the fins are on was totally out of whack.




I dropped the $1500 for the new unit. From what I could find looking around online, a new impeller, having the whole unit refreshed, and fixing the casing from where the fins hit it would have cost me close to $1200. We originally had the price of the V1 down to $1300 with me exchanging my unit, but I changed my mind at the last moment and decided to keep my damaged V2 so the price went back up to $1500.
I'm going to give Vortech a call tomorrow and see what they'd charge to rebuild it.. maybe I can get it fixed and get some of my money back.


I got the V1 installed in a couple hours, and drove the car around real quick. Feels pretty much like it did before, but this V1 is a lot louder than my V2. But now I'm getting a P2196 and P2198 DTC, I cleared them and I'll see if they come back on my drive to work tomorrow.
